Pets.com joins list of online failures

There goes another one

Pets.com is as dead as a dodo.

The online pet-supply store brought down the ‘cybershuttters’ yesterday - adding another company to the growing list of dot-com failures.

The San Francisco-based company laid off 255 of its 320 employees and said it plans to try to sell off its major assets, including its Web site, product inventory, distribution centre equipment and its well-known sock puppet logo.

In Tuesday's announcement, Pets.com disclosed that it hired Merrill Lynch & Co. to locate prospective buyers but that "fewer than eight" of the 50-plus companies contacted by the investment banking firm were even prepared to visit the online retailer to explore a possible purchase.
